PPP1CC, also known as serine/threonine-protein phosphatase PP1-gamma catalytic subunit, is essential for cell division, and participates in the regulation of glycogen metabolism, muscle contractility and protein synthesis. This protein is involved in regulation of ionic conductances and long-term synaptic plasticity and may play an important role in dephosphorylating substrates such as the postsynaptic density-associated Ca2+/calmodulin dependent protein kinase II.
